On Thursday, two American Airlines planes collided on the taxiway at Reagan Washington National Airport. The incident involved American Airlines Flight 5490, a Bombardier CRJ 900 headed to Charleston, South Carolina, and American Flight 4522, an Embraer E175 bound for New York JFK. Despite the collision, no injuries were reported among the passengers, including several members of Congress onboard.
